Izinzuzo Eziyinhloko (uma kuqhathaniswa nama-Alloys Afanayo)
I-CuNi44 strip ivelele emndenini we-copper-nickel alloy ngenxa yezinzuzo zayo zokusebenza okuqondiswe kuzo:
- Ukumelana Nogesi Okuzinzile Kakhulu: Ukumelana okungu-49 ± 2 μΩ·cm ku-20°C kanye ne-coefficient yokushisa ephansi yokumelana (TCR: ±40 ppm/°C, -50°C kuya ku-150°C)—okungcono kakhulu kune-CuNi30 (TCR ±50 ppm/°C) kanye nethusi elimsulwa, okuqinisekisa ukugeleza okuncane kokumelana emishinini yokulinganisa ngokunemba.
- Ukumelana Okuphezulu Kokugqwala: Imelana nokugqwala komoya, amanzi ahlanzekile, kanye nezindawo zamakhemikhali ezithambile; idlula ukuhlolwa kwe-ASTM B117 salt spray kwamahora ayi-1000 nge-oxidation encane, esebenza kahle kakhulu kunethusi nethusi ezindaweni zezimboni ezinzima.
- Ukwakheka Okuhle Kakhulu: Ukuqina okuphezulu kwenza ukugoqa okubandayo kube ama-gauge amancane (0.01mm) kanye nokunyathela okuyinkimbinkimbi (isb., ama-resistor grids, ama-sensor clips) ngaphandle kokuqhekeka—kusebenza kangcono kunezicucu ze-alloy ezinobunzima obukhulu njenge-CuNi50.
- Izakhiwo Zomshini Ezilinganiselayo: Amandla okunamathela angu-450-550 MPa (ahlanganisiwe) kanye nokunwebeka okungu-≥25% ahambisana kahle phakathi kokuqina kwesakhiwo kanye nokucutshungulwa, afanele kokubili izingxenye ezithwala umthwalo kanye nezingxenye ezisebenza ngokunemba.
- Ukunemba Okungabizi Kakhulu: Kunikeza ukusebenza okufana nezinsimbi zensimbi eziyigugu (isb., i-manganin) ngentengo ephansi, okwenza kube kuhle kakhulu ezingxenyeni zikagesi ezinembile ezikhiqizwa ngobuningi.
Imininingwane Yobuchwepheshe
| Isici | Inani (Elijwayelekile) |
| Ukwakheka Kwamakhemikhali (wt%) | Cu: 55.0-57.0%; Ni: 43.0-45.0%; I-Fe: ≤0.5%; UMn: ≤1.0%; Isimo: ≤0.1%; C: ≤0.05% |
| Ububanzi Bokujiya | 0.01mm – 2.0mm (ukubekezelela: ±0.0005mm ngo-≤0.1mm; ±0.001mm ngo->0.1mm) |
| Ububanzi Bebanga | 5mm – 600mm (ukubekezelela: ±0.05mm ngo-≤100mm; ±0.1mm ngo->100mm) |
| Izinketho Zesimo Sengqondo | Ithambile (ifakwe uhhafu), Iqinile (igoqwe ngokubandayo) |
| Amandla Okudonsa | Ithambile: 450-500 MPa; Ukuqina okuyingxenye: 500-550 MPa; Ukuqina: 550-600 MPa |
| Amandla Okukhiqiza | Ithambile: 150-200 MPa; Ukuqina okuyingxenye: 300-350 MPa; Ukuqina: 450-500 MPa |
| Ukwelulwa (25°C) | Okuthambile: ≥25%; Ukuqina okuyingxenye: 15-20%; Okuqinile: ≤10% |
| Ubulukhuni (HV) | Okuthambile: 120-140; Ukuqina okuyingxenye: 160-180; Ukuqina: 200-220 |
| Ukumelana (20°C) | 49 ± 2 μΩ·cm |
| Ukushisa Okuphezulu (20°C) | 22 W/(m·K) |
| Ibanga Lokushisa Lokusebenza | -50°C kuya ku-300°C (ukusetshenziswa okuqhubekayo) |

Izicelo Ezijwayelekile
- Izingxenye Zikagesi: Ama-resistors e-wirewound anembile, ama-current shunts, kanye nezinto ze-potentiometer—ezibalulekile kumamitha kagesi kanye nemishini yokulinganisa.
- Izinzwa Nezinsimbi: Amagridi okulinganisa ukucindezeleka, ama-substrate ezinzwa zokushisa, kanye nama-transducer okucindezela (ukumelana okuzinzile kuqinisekisa ukunemba kokulinganisa).
- Ihadiwe Yezimboni: Iziqeshana, amatheminali, kanye nezixhumi ezingamelani nokugqwala zezinhlelo zasolwandle, zamakhemikhali, kanye neze-HVAC.
- Amadivayisi Ezokwelapha: Izingxenye ezincane emishinini yokuxilonga kanye nezinzwa ezigqokwayo (ezihambisana ne-bio futhi ezingagqwali).
- Izindiza Nezimoto: Izinto zokushisa ezisebenzisa amandla aphansi kanye nokuxhumana kukagesi ezinqolobaneni zezindiza kanye nezinhlelo zokulawula izimoto zikagesi.
